GOP lawmaker insult took center stage when James Comer publicly told Rep. Robert Garcia to “mature up” over his repeated demands for the release of Jeffrey Epstein files. This clash reveals deeper tensions within congressional oversight efforts and sheds light on the battle to access sensitive documents tied to a high-profile investigation. You will get a clear view of Comer’s critique, Garcia’s persistence, and the stakes involved in the ongoing push for transparency. Comer’s remarks mark a notable moment in this heated debate, highlighting how political dynamics complicate the pursuit of Epstein-related records.

What Sparked the GOP Lawmaker Insult Between Comer and Garcia?

The conflict ignited when Rep. James Comer publicly told Rep. Robert Garcia to “mature up” amid Garcia’s persistent calls for the release of Jeffrey Epstein files. This GOP lawmaker insult was more than a personal slight; it underscored the frustrations brewing over the handling of sensitive material linked to Epstein’s investigation. Comer views Garcia’s approach as reckless and politically motivated, while Garcia insists transparency is non-negotiable for justice and accountability.

Underlying this clash is a broader debate about congressional oversight boundaries and the political theater surrounding Epstein’s case. The insult became a flashpoint in a wider struggle over control, access, and timing of releasing documents that could implicate powerful figures. This tension spotlights deep divisions on Capitol Hill about how to navigate highly charged investigations without compromising procedure or public trust.
